The head of the Federal Investigation Agency’s (FIA) cyber-crime division Captain (retd) Mohammad Shoaib has revealed that customers data from “almost all major Pakistani banks” was stolen in a recent security breach. 

The statement from Mohammad Shoaib comes after Group-IB, a global cybersecurity firm released a report on a new dump of Pakistani credit and debit cards on dark web forums.

According to reports, almost 20,000 cards from over 20 banks were dumped on the dark web.

Here also some precautionary measures users can take to guard themselves against credit/debit card theft.

1. Change your banking codes on a regular basis. The State Bank of Pakistan advises changing all your codes if not every month then at least every two months.

2. Ensure that international use of your card is restricted. Remove the restriction temporarily if an international transaction is required.

3. If you are unsure about a transaction, contact your bank immediately so your card can be blocked.
